Santa Fe: Bocaccio Press, 1975. First edition thus. Case edges are worn; External paper surfaces somewhat soiled; Otherwise excellent condition.. Presentation copy inscribed by the illustrator(s) as 'M Taylor McCall' and parenthetically signed 'Love Mick', in addition to standard copy inscription; ('Taylor McCall' is the artist couple Mick Taylor and Sheena McCall, they are friends of the singer Donovan Leitch who provided illustrations for his albums Sunshine Superman and Mellow Yellow and illustrated his 1970 collection of writings, Behind Us, also published by Boccaccio Press); Number 15 of 150 copies, illustrated edition of Ouspensky's original of 1913, with 23 multi-colour silk-screen prints and letterpress in loose gatherings, heightened in gold and silver, pages measure 23 3/4" X 16 1/4"; Printed on special order hemp paper made by Luigi Amatruda in Amalfi, Italy, untrimmed with deckled-edges; Includes an introduction booklet, likely the prospectus, untrimmed; In original half calf portfolio… Read More

Hand numberd '94' of 100 copies; Errata pasted in on front paste-down; 289 pages. King was a member of Orage's groups in New York, where he served in a teaching role for certain groups. He also is the only one to have set down in publishable form what Orage digested of Gurdjieff''s teaching.

This is the first copy we have seen without suede covered paper covers; With one Registration bank, numbered 530; Ownership signature of Dr. Alfons Paquet, Alfons Paquet was a German writer who knew Alexandre de Salzmann in Germany, while on a tour of Turkey he crossed paths with de Salzmann while the latter was with Gurdjieff, later he helped set up readings of Beelzebub's Tales in germany (see Webb); 89 pages.

Two volumes: Facsimile of Manuscript - Hardback in full calf leather binding incorporating skrying mirror. 416pp coloured pages (of which 209pp are blank) It is clearly stated to be the book of the Fratres Lucis and is bound to match the appearance of the book as Herbert envisaged and drew it in the frontispiece of the manuscript. All edges are hand gilded, thus avoiding the too shiny gaudiness of machine gilding. Leather joint, decorated endpapers. The front cover has a real satin silk doublure (a traditional bookbinding device, a panel of silk set into the inside of the boards). Inset into the doublure on the front board is a reproduction of a sigil from the book which features an eye within concentric circles.
